PURPOSE: This rule establishes the various fees and charges for the Acupuncturist Advisory Committee.
- (1) All fees shall be paid by cashier’s check, personal check, money order, or other method approved by the division and must be made payable to the Acupuncturist Advisory 20 CSR 2015-1
Committee.
- (2) No fee will be refunded should any license be surrendered, suspended, or revoked during the term for which the license is issued.
(3) The fees are established as follows:
- (A) Acupuncturist Application Fee $200.00
- (B) Acupuncturist Biennial Renewal Fee $100.00
- (C) Fingerprinting Fee Amount to be determined by the Missouri State Highway Patrol
- (D) Insufficient Funds Check Charge Fee $ 25.00
- (E) Late Renewal Fee $ 50.00
- (4) Fees may be returned to an applicant or licensee, at the advisory committee’s discretion, with the applicant or licensee submitting a written request to the advisory committee explaining the reason the fee should be returned.
